Java接口中的方法默认修饰符

作为一名经验丰富的开发者,我将教会你如何实现Java接口中的方法默认修饰符。下面是整个实现过程的步骤:

  1. 定义一个接口
  2. 实现接口的类中定义默认修饰符方法
  3. 创建类的实例并调用默认修饰符方法

下面是详细的实现步骤及代码示例:

步骤1:定义一个接口

首先,我们需要定义一个接口。接口是一种规范,它定义了一组相关的方法。在接口中,我们可以定义默认修饰符方法。下面是一个示例接口的代码:

public interface MyInterface {
    // 默认修饰符方法
    default void myMethod() {
        System.out.println("这是一个默认修饰符方法");
    }
}

在上面的代码中,我们定义了一个名为MyInterface的接口,并在接口中定义了一个默认修饰符方法myMethod()。该方法的作用是输出一条信息。

步骤2:实现接口的类中定义默认修饰符方法

接下来,我们需要在实现接口的类中定义默认修饰符方法。实现接口的类必须实现接口中定义的所有方法,包括默认修饰符方法。下面是一个示例类的代码:

public class MyClass implements MyInterface {
    // 实现默认修饰符方法
    public void myMethod() {
        System.out.println("实现了默认修饰符方法");
    }
}

在上面的代码中,我们定义了一个名为MyClass的类,并实现了MyInterface接口。在类中,我们实现了接口中定义的默认修饰符方法myMethod(),并输出了一条不同的信息。

步骤3:创建类的实例并调用默认修饰符方法

最后,我们需要创建类的实例,并调用默认修饰符方法。下面是一个示例的代码:

public class Main {
    public static void main(String[] args) {
        // 创建类的实例
        MyClass myClass = new MyClass();
        
        // 调用默认修饰符方法
        myClass.myMethod();
    }
}

在上面的代码中,我们创建了MyClass类的实例,并通过调用myMethod()方法来调用默认修饰符方法。运行程序后,将会输出以下信息:

实现了默认修饰符方法

通过以上三个步骤,我们成功实现了Java接口中的方法默认修饰符。

下面是旅程图的示例:

journey
    title Java接口中的方法默认修饰符
    section 定义一个接口
    section 实现接口的类中定义默认修饰符方法
    section 创建类的实例并调用默认修饰符方法

希望通过这篇文章,你已经了解了Java接口中方法默认修饰符的实现过程,并能够成功使用默认修饰符方法。祝你在编程学习的旅程中取得更多的进步!